I do have a Compaq Presario according to the massive lettering on the front of my PC, I'm not sure if it's a 5000, but it was a relatively common model when I got the PC.

The Sound and Multimedia device simply states my Sound Playback as being ESS Allegro, no more, no less.
And yes, there is a yellow "!" mark next to the ES1888 Plug and Play Audiodrive (WDM) when I troubleshoot it tells me that

"This device cannot find enough free resources that it can use. (Code 12)

If you want to use this device, you will need to disable one of the other devices on this system."

This is an explanation of code 12
http://support.microsoft.com/kb/310123/EN-US/
as you can see, both audio are trying to use the same resources, now one has to be Disabled and this could mean going into the BIOS, I'm not up on this procedure the only way I know is through Device manager, I'll check with some of the techie guys on the site, someone should be able to help.

An older PC, I recently reformatted and it booted up with no sound drivers. I found the Motherboard make was Shuttle so i've finally managed to download the "Audio.zip" driver for my model but the setup.exe won't run after I unzipped it.

Following a good 12 hours looking into this on the net somebody posted to go into BIOS and check the driver needed in intergrated prephials (sp?). So I found out that mine is SIS - 7012.

I downloaded a driver for that and got a 536870397 error msg. I found the fix for that but it appears very long winded (removing all trace of the driver, burning a CD, etc,etc) and is way out of my technical range. Most computer things are.

I don't have the driver CD anymore. Strangely during my tinkering it installed some Bluetooth device as a driver (the GF's) played but had no sound in WMP. I have removed the bluetooth driver.

I downloaded that AC97 gizmo and got a yellow exclamation mark and a code 10.

I'd be grateful for any advice provided.
